WebMar 30, 2010 · It takes time to get the genetic test results, and the provider has to start the patient on Coumadin before the test results are even available. Genetics is only estimated to contribute about 70% to dose requirements, and variations in the other 30% could outweigh simplistic dose estimates based on DNA. WebJan 31, 2024 · There are different types of blood thinners: Anticoagulants, such as heparin or warfarin (also called Coumadin), slow down your body's process of making clots. Antiplatelets, such as aspirin and clopidogrel, prevent blood cells called platelets from clumping together to form a clot. Antiplatelets are mainly taken by people who have had … WebMar 7, 2024 · What is Coumadin? Coumadin is an anticoagulant (blood thinner). Warfarin reduces the formation of blood clots. Coumadin is used to treat or prevent blood clots in veins or arteries, which can reduce the risk of stroke, heart attack, or other serious conditions. Warfarin is intermediate-acting; a peak effect is achieved in 36 to 72 hours and the anticoagulant effect persists for two to five days. The drug is rapidly and completely absorbed from the gastrointestinal tract.
